Croatia
This Southeast European gem is widely known for two things—its medieval architecture and being the location for King’s Landing on “Game of Thrones”. On top of all that, this was also the place where Billy and Gabo first met on primetime series Make It With You! Liza Soberano and Enrique Gil even made a two-part travel vlog to show you what Dubrovnik has to offer.
Italy
Another European country that LizQuen visited was Italy, this time for the 2016 teleserye Dolce Amore. Italy’s culture is rich in the arts, music, fashion and food. This the home of pasta. They are one of the biggest wine producers in the world. There is also the annual much-anticipated Milan Fashion Week. Some of the most famous composers and painters in the world like Leonardo da Vinci and Antonio Vivaldi are Italian.
South Korea
Who doesn’t want to visit Seoul? With one hit K-Drama and one hot oppa after the other, this country is on the top of many bucket lists. Even the cast of Home Sweetie Home visited this peninsula. One of the most popular tourist destinations is its Gyeongbokgung Palace, the biggest and grandest palace in South Korea. Many K-Dramas has shot scenes here, including “Goblin”. South Korea also offers a wide variety of street food like their spicy rice cakes, Korean sweet pancakes, Korean sushi, among others.
Japan
Tony Gonzaga and the rest of her Home Sweetie Home family also visited Japan! Dubbed as the “Land of the Rising Sun”, this Asian country is known for its well-preserved culture and tradition. Popular tourist locations include the memorial statue of Hachiko, the Akita Dog whose story was honored in 1934 for his remarkable loyal. For nature lovers, there is Mount Fuji, the tallest mountain in Japan. This will be an extra special treat for Filipinos because of the snow and different snow activities!
New York City, New York
If city sightseeing is more your style, then New York City would be perfect for you! Kim Chiu and Xian Lim visited the Big Apple back in 2016 for the teleserye The Story of Us. Here you will find Times Square, one of the busiest intersections in the world. Aside from the blinding neon signs and electronic billboards, this is also an entertainment center because of the multiple Broadway theaters and cinemas.
San Francisco, California
From the East coast, now it is time to drop by the West coast with Nadine Lustre and James Reid for On the Wings of Love. This city has the last manually operated cable car system in the world. Another manmade wonder is the Bay Bridge, which has been serving the public since 1936! But there is an even more famous bridge here—the Golden Gate bridge. Built in the 1930s, this is one of the biggest suspension bridges in the world.
Greece
Back to Europe, Greece offers centuries worth of history for its tourist like JaDine who visited back in 2016 for the series Till I Met You. Ancient Greek is one of the oldest civilizations in the world. Its capital, Athens, is the birthplace of Democracy. Today, the country is known for Instagram worthy landscapes, like Santorini’s whitewashed houses.
Germany
Bea Alonzo and Ian Veneracion would suggest dropping by Germany after their 2017 visit for A Love to Last. This Western European country has an annual folk festival that you might have heard of—Oktoberfest! Every year, more than six million people from around the world attend this event. Germany is also known for football. In fact, they are tied with Italy for the second most wins at the World Cup.
